The Problem: Dev Environments Running 24/7 #

Our development Azure environment was costing $8,400/month. A significant chunk was:

  • Azure Firewall Premium: ~$1,200/month (running 24/7)
  • VPN Gateways (2x): ~$800/month
  • ExpressRoute Gateway: ~$600/month

Developers needed these resources during work hours (8am-6pm Pacific). But they ran all night, every weekend, and during holidays.

Manual reminders didn’t work:

  • “Remember to deallocate the firewall when done!”
  • “Please shut down VPN gateways over the weekend!”

People forget. They’re busy. They’re focused on shipping code, not infrastructure costs.

The Solution: Scheduled Deallocation Pipeline #

I created an Azure DevOps pipeline that runs every night and deallocates expensive resources in dev environments:

# azure-pipelines-cleanup.yml
name: Nightly Dev Environment Cleanup

schedules:
- cron: "30 6 * * *"  # 6:30 UTC = 11:30 PM Pacific (after work hours)
  displayName: Nightly cleanup
  branches:
    include:
    - main
  always: true  # Run even if no code changes

trigger: none  # Only run on schedule

variables:
  - group: platform-dev-credentials
  - name: subscriptionId
    value: 'xxxxxxxx-xxxx-xxxx-xxxx-xxxxxxxxxxxx'

jobs:
- job: DeallocateExpensiveResources
  displayName: 'Deallocate Dev Environment Resources'
  pool:
    vmImage: 'ubuntu-latest'

  steps:
  - task: AzureCLI@2
    displayName: 'Deallocate Azure Firewall'
    inputs:
      azureSubscription: 'Azure-Dev-ServiceConnection'
      scriptType: 'bash'
      scriptLocation: 'inlineScript'
      inlineScript: |
        echo "Deallocating Azure Firewall in Dev environment..."

        # Deallocate firewall (preserves configuration, stops billing)
        az network firewall delete \
          --name fw-hub-dev \
          --resource-group rg-hub-dev

        echo "Firewall deallocated. Configuration preserved in ARM templates."

  - task: AzureCLI@2
    displayName: 'Deallocate VPN Gateways'
    inputs:
      azureSubscription: 'Azure-Dev-ServiceConnection'
      scriptType: 'bash'
      scriptLocation: 'inlineScript'
      inlineScript: |
        echo "Deallocating VPN Gateways..."

        az network vnet-gateway delete --name vng-hub-dev-vpn1 --resource-group rg-hub-dev
        az network vnet-gateway delete --name vng-hub-dev-vpn2 --resource-group rg-hub-dev

        echo "VPN Gateways deallocated."

  - task: AzureCLI@2
    displayName: 'Deallocate ExpressRoute Gateway'
    inputs:
      azureSubscription: 'Azure-Dev-ServiceConnection'
      scriptType: 'bash'
      scriptLocation: 'inlineScript'
      inlineScript: |
        echo "Deallocating ExpressRoute Gateway..."

        az network vnet-gateway delete --name vng-hub-dev-er --resource-group rg-hub-dev

        echo "ExpressRoute Gateway deallocated."

  - task: Bash@3
    displayName: 'Send Notification'
    inputs:
      targetType: 'inline'
      script: |
        echo "✅ Dev environment cleanup completed at $(date)"
        echo "Resources will be recreated on next deployment."
        # Add Teams/Slack notification here if desired

Morning Redeployment (Optional) #

For teams that want resources ready in the morning, add a morning pipeline:

schedules:
- cron: "0 15 * * 1-5"  # 3:00 PM UTC = 7:00 AM Pacific, Mon-Fri
  displayName: Morning environment prep
  branches:
    include:
    - main

But we found developers prefer on-demand deployment - they run the deployment pipeline when needed (takes 60 minutes, but they control it).

Critical Safety Measures #

Never run cleanup against production:

schedules:
- cron: "30 6 * * *"
  branches:
    exclude:
    - main  # Or use explicit environment checks

Add subscription validation:

CURRENT_SUB=$(az account show --query id -o tsv)
ALLOWED_SUB="xxxxxxxx-xxxx-xxxx-xxxx-xxxxxxxxxxxx"  # Azure-Dev

if [ "$CURRENT_SUB" != "$ALLOWED_SUB" ]; then
    echo "❌ ERROR: Not running in Dev subscription!"
    echo "Current: $CURRENT_SUB"
    echo "Expected: $ALLOWED_SUB"
    exit 1
fi

The Results #

Cost Savings:

  • Before: $8,400/month for dev environment
  • After: $2,500/month (70% reduction)
  • Annual savings: ~$70,000

What We Deallocate Nightly:

  • Azure Firewall Premium: ~$1,200/mo → $40/mo (96% savings)
  • VPN Gateways (2x): ~$800/mo → $0 (100% savings, recreated on-demand)
  • ExpressRoute Gateway: ~$600/mo → $0 (100% savings, recreated on-demand)

Developer Impact:

  • ✅ Zero complaints (they just redeploy when needed)
  • ✅ Configuration always preserved (in IaC)
  • ✅ Faster iteration (forces IaC testing)

Why This Works #

  1. Automated = Reliable: No human decisions, no forgotten shutdowns
  2. IaC-Friendly: Encourages treating infrastructure as code, not pets
  3. Configurable: Easy to adjust schedule or skip cleanup on-demand
  4. Auditable: Pipeline logs show exactly what was deallocated and when

Alternative Approaches #

For VM-heavy environments:

# Stop all VMs in resource group
az vm deallocate --ids $(az vm list -g rg-dev --query "[].id" -o tsv)

For Azure Virtual Desktop:

# Stop session hosts (preserves configuration)
az desktopvirtualization sessionhost update \
  --resource-group rg-avd-dev \
  --host-pool-name hp-dev \
  --name sessionhost-0 \
  --allow-new-session false

az vm deallocate --ids $(az vm list -g rg-avd-dev --query "[].id" -o tsv)
